What does "leaked" content actually mean in this context?

When people talk about "leaked" content, it typically means private photos, videos, or other materials that were shared without the owner's permission. This might happen through hacking, unauthorized sharing by someone who had access, or other means that bypass the creator's consent. It's a very serious breach of privacy, that.

How can creators protect their content and privacy online?

Creators can take several steps to protect their content and privacy. This includes using strong, unique passwords, enabling two-factor authentication on all platforms, being careful about what information they share publicly, and understanding the privacy settings of the platforms they use. They might also consider watermarking their content or using legal agreements for exclusive material. It's a continuous effort, really, to keep things secure.
